Mittens and the Magical Forest

In a quiet village nestled between rolling hills and towering trees, there lived a curious cat named Mittens. With her striking white fur, patchwork paws, and deep green eyes, Mittens was no ordinary feline. She had always been intrigued by the world beyond the cozy walls of her home, and it was one such adventure that would lead her to a magical forest—a place where reality and fantasy intertwined in ways she never imagined.

The Curious Cat’s Journey Begins

Mittens’ life was peaceful, filled with the familiar comfort of warm naps and hearty meals, but she often gazed out the window, wondering about the world that lay beyond. Her favorite spot was a large, sun-dappled window sill where she could watch birds, squirrels, and the occasional wandering fox. But one crisp autumn morning, as she stretched her paws and yawned, something caught her eye. A mysterious flicker of light danced among the trees in the distance, just beyond the edge of the forest.

Intrigued, Mittens padded to the door, pushed it open with a soft meow, and stepped outside. The wind was gentle, and the scent of pine and earth filled the air. With every step, the village behind her faded, and soon, Mittens found herself at the edge of the forest. The tall trees loomed above her like ancient guardians, and the path ahead seemed to whisper with the promise of adventure.

A Forest Like No Other

As Mittens ventured deeper into the forest, she quickly realized this wasn’t an ordinary woodland. The trees seemed to hum with energy, their leaves shimmering in hues of silver and gold. Flowers that glowed softly in the twilight decorated the forest floor, and every now and then, small creatures—none of which she had ever seen before—scurried past her. There were firefly-like insects that twinkled like stars, and mushrooms that emitted a soft, calming melody when touched.

The deeper Mittens went, the more she felt as though she were being watched, but not in a frightening way. It was as though the forest itself was aware of her presence. Suddenly, a figure appeared before her—a small, glowing creature, no bigger than her paw. It had the body of a rabbit but with delicate wings, shimmering like glass.

“Welcome, Mittens,” the creature said in a voice that sounded like the rustling of leaves. “I am Thistles, one of the keepers of the Magical Forest. What brings you here?”

Mittens blinked in surprise. She had never heard of a magical forest, but here she was, standing in its midst. Thistle smiled and explained that the forest was a place where nature and magic coexisted. It was a sanctuary for creatures and beings who sought refuge from the outside world, and only those with an open heart and a sense of wonder could find it.

The Heart of the Forest

Thistle guided Mittens deeper into the forest, where the trees grew even taller, their trunks covered in soft moss. As they walked, the air became thick with the scent of sweet fruit, and a soft, golden light illuminated everything. The further they traveled, the more Mittens felt an odd sense of belonging.

In the center of the forest, they arrived at a large clearing where a pool of crystal-clear water reflected the sky above. The water seemed to shimmer with magical energy, its surface rippling with colors that didn’t exist in the natural world. Thistle explained that this was the Heart of the Forest—a place where the magic of the land was concentrated, and where one could make a wish or seek guidance.

Mittens gazed at the pool, her green eyes wide with wonder. “Can I make a wish?” she asked, her voice barely a whisper.

Thistle nodded. “Yes, Mittens. The Heart listens to those who seek guidance with a pure heart. What is it that you desire?”

Mittens thought for a moment. She wasn’t sure what to wish for—she had a warm home, food, and the company of kind humans. But as she looked at the shimmering water, she realized there was something else she longed for: adventure. She wanted to explore more, to discover the mysteries of the world beyond her village. Without hesitation, she spoke her wish aloud.

“I wish to always find adventure, no matter where I go.”

The water rippled, and for a brief moment, it glowed with a soft, golden light. Thistle smiled gently. “Your wish has been granted, Mittens. With every step you take, the world will reveal new wonders, new mysteries for you to uncover.”

The Return Home

With her wish granted, Mittens felt a sense of peace. It was time to return to the village, but she knew that her life would never be the same. The forest had opened her eyes to the magic that existed beyond her familiar world, and she carried that knowledge with her, even as she trotted back down the path leading to her home.

As Mittens crossed the threshold of her house, she looked out the window at the forest in the distance. It was still there, its trees swaying gently in the breeze. The world was filled with possibilities, and she knew that no matter where her paws would take her, there would always be a new adventure waiting just beyond the horizon.

And so, Mittens lived her life as a cat with a secret: the knowledge that magic was real, and that every day held the promise of something extraordinary.
